Which City is Right for You?

Antioch leads in median household income at $94,256, while billings offers more affordable housing with a median home price of $398,212. On public safety, Billings is safer with a violent crime rate of 433 per 100,000 residents, compared to 503 in Antioch. Billings has a lower unemployment rate at 3.5%, and Billings has cleaner air (PM2.5 avg 7.4 µg/m³). For overall health outcomes, Antioch scores better with a lower obesity rate of 32.9%.
